Square End Island (GBR) | 62° 09' 28.6" S | 58° 59' 31.2" W | Island |
Name ID: 111348
Place ID: 13878
off NW coast of Fildes Peninsula, King George Island, was charted by DI, 1934-35, and named descriptively (Nelson and others, chart, 1935b; BA, 1948, p.151; APC, 1955, p.20; DOS 610 sheet W 62 58, 1968). Square-end Island (Nelson, 1935; BA, 1942, p.40). Isla Square-end (Argentina. MM chart 104, 1949). Isla Cuadrada [=square island] (Argentina. MM, 1953, p.200; Pierrou, 1970, p.276; Chile. IHA, 1974, p.88). The island was photographed from the air by FIDASE, 1956-57. Square End Ilha (Brazil. Península Fildes map, 1984 ) |

Square End Island (USA) | 62° 10' 00.0" S | 58° 59' 00.0" W | Island |
Name ID: 132053
Place ID: 13878
Small island 3 mi NNE of the W tip of King George Island, in the South Shetland Islands. The descriptive name appears to have been applied by DI personnel on the Discovery II who charted the island in 1935. |
